When you start looking at custom window treatments, the final bill depends on a few specific choices. First, the material makes a big difference; real wood or heavy-duty blackout fabrics naturally cost more than standard synthetics. The size and shape of your windows also play a role, as larger or custom-arched openings require more material and specialized hardware. Current trends often favor natural materials like wood and bamboo, reflecting Portland's connection to nature. Smart blinds with automation are also popular for convenience. Layering blinds with drapes is another trend for added style and light control. Many homeowners are also looking for sustainable and energy-efficient options.
